Advancements in AI technology for healthcare
The advancements in AI technology have revolutionized the way healthcare is delivered.
Some of the important advancements in AI technology for healthcare include:
Disease diagnosis
Artificial Intelligence Technology can help in the accurate diagnosis of diseases by analyzing patient data and providing insights to healthcare providers. This can help in the early detection and treatment of diseases, leading to better patient outcomes.
Drug development
Artificial Intelligence Technology can help develop new drugs by analyzing large amounts of data and identifying patterns that can be used to develop new drugs. This can help develop more effective drugs with fewer side effects.
Personalized medicine
Artificial Intelligence Technology can help develop personalized medicine by analyzing patient data and providing insights to healthcare providers. This can help in the delivery of more personalized treatment plans that are tailored to the individual needs of patients.
Robotics in surgery
Robotic surgery has been made possible due to Artificial Intelligence Technology. It allows for precise, accurate, and minimally invasive surgeries that reduce the risk of complications and improve patient outcomes.
Remote monitoring
Artificial Intelligence Technology can help remotely monitor patients by analyzing patient data and providing insights to healthcare providers. This can help in the early detection of complications and allow for timely interventions.

The future of AI technology in healthcare
The future of AI technology in healthcare is exciting, with the potential for significant advancements in the coming years.
Here are some of the developments we can expect in the future of Artificial Intelligence Technology in healthcare:
- Predictive analytics: Artificial Intelligence Technology will be able to analyze patient data to predict potential diseases or complications, enabling healthcare providers to take proactive measures to prevent or treat these conditions.
- Virtual assistants: Virtual assistants powered by Artificial Intelligence Technology will be able to provide patients with personalized health advice, monitor their health, and remind them to take their medication.
- Wearable technology: Wearable technology such as smartwatches and fitness trackers will become more sophisticated, allowing for continuous monitoring of patient health and the collection of real-time data.
- Telemedicine: Telemedicine will become more prevalent and efficient with the help of Artificial Intelligence Technology. This will enable remote consultations and better management of chronic diseases.
- Precision medicine: Artificial Intelligence Technology will help develop precision medicine, where treatments are tailored to patients’ needs based on their genetic makeup. This will lead to more personalized treatment plans that can improve patient outcomes.
- Medical imaging: Artificial Intelligence Technology will improve medical imaging by providing more accurate and detailed images that can aid in diagnosing and treating diseases.
- Drug discovery: Artificial Intelligence Technology will help discover new drugs and treatments by analyzing data and identifying potential drug targets.
- Electronic health records (EHRs): Artificial Intelligence Technology will make EHRs more efficient and effective by providing healthcare providers with predictive analytics and data-driven insights.
- Disease management: Artificial Intelligence Technology will improve disease management by providing real-time data and insights to healthcare providers, enabling them to make better decisions and provide more personalized treatment plans.
The future of Artificial Intelligence Technology in healthcare is promising, with the potential to improve patient outcomes and transform the way healthcare is delivered. However, ensuring that Artificial Intelligence Technology is implemented responsibly and ethically is important, focusing on patient privacy and security.
